Transaction 14d869e10f0dcb8e81d7a4ccaddafaa24ea43e024721354648856ffb8cbe424c
1 Input
1 Output
-
14d869e10f0dcb8e81d7a4ccaddafaa24ea43e024721354648856ffb8cbe424c:0
- value
- 2630434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25dca6bd40b73f540f8779cdfec3df3b7e102143 OP_EQUAL
- address
- MBMMZehRt2zmZK8LUPbHU6FxGnEwTPGaop